Gout is a form of arthritis that can cause severe pain and swelling in the joints. While medication may be necessary to manage gout symptoms in some cases, there are also natural remedies that can help alleviate the pain and reduce the frequency of gout attacks. In this article, we will explore some effective natural remedies for gout that can be used in conjunction with medical treatment or as an alternative for those who prefer a more holistic approach.

1. Stay Hydrated

One of the simplest yet most effective ways to manage gout is to stay well-hydrated. Drinking plenty of water helps to flush out uric acid from the body and prevent the formation of urate crystals in the joints. Aim to drink at least 8 cups of water per day and avoid sugary beverages that can exacerbate gout symptoms.

2. Follow a Gout-Friendly Diet

Adopting a gout-friendly diet can significantly reduce gout symptoms and prevent future attacks. Foods that are high in purines such as red meat, organ meats, and seafood should be limited or avoided. Instead, choose low-purine foods like f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and low-fat dairy products. Additionally, incorporating foods rich in antioxidants and anti-inflammatory properties such as cherries, berries, and leafy greens can be beneficial for reducing gout inflammation.

3. Maintain a Healthy Weight

Excess weight can contribute to gout by increasing uric acid levels in the body. Losing weight, if necessary, can help lower the risk of gout attacks. Adopting a balanced diet and engaging in regular physical activity can aid in weight management and reduce the severity of gout symptoms.

4. Apply Cold or Heat Therapy

Applying ice packs or cold compresses to the affected joint can help reduce gout-related inflammation and relieve pain. Cold therapy can be especially effective during acute gout attacks. In contrast, heat therapy such as warm compresses or warm baths can help relax the muscles and improve blood circulation, easing chronic gout pain.

5. Use Natural Supplements

Certain natural supplements have shown promise in managing gout symptoms. For instance, tart cherry extract and celery seed extract have anti-inflammatory properties that can help reduce gout flare-ups. However, it is important to consult with a healthcare professional before starting any new supplements to determine the appropriate dosage and potential interactions with medications.

6. Stay Active

Regular exercise not only helps with weight management but also enhances joint mobility and reduces the frequency of gout attacks. Low-impact activities like swimming, biking, and yoga can be particularly beneficial for individuals with gout since they minimize stress on the affected joints. Remember to start slowly and gradually increase the intensity and duration of exercise as tolerated.

While medication can be essential for managing gout, natural remedies can be used as adjunctive measures or alternative treatments for those who opt for a drug-free approach. Incorporating these lifestyle modifications and natural remedies into your daily routine can provide relief from gout symptoms and improve overall quality of life. However, it is crucial to consult with a healthcare professional for a comprehensive treatment plan tailored to your specific needs.
